CTE Mission Statement:

“Through the provision of challenging career & technical programs, we ensure that students possess the necessary 21st century skills and attitudes to achieve their maximum potential in a chosen career or post – secondary education.”

Program/Class Name 2011 May

Enrollment

2012 May

Enrollment

Animal Science 31 35

Auto Body 21 13

Auto Mechanics 47 50

Broadband 6 5

Computer Repair & Networking 11 18

Construction Technology 17 18

Cosmetology 33 30

Culinary Arts 61 56

Custom Fabrication &

Metalworking

14 14

Early Childhood 26 24

Graphic Design 11 8

New Vision Health 6 11

Health Occupations 61 73

Natural Resources 30 42

Public Safety Services 27 36

LPN 51 41

CORE 21 26

Community Based Work Program 17 16

GED 9 14

Pre Tech 18 27

Total 518 553

Win, Place & Show at Skills USA 2012 Sullivan BOCES Career & Tech won multiple awards at the Spring New York State SkillsUSA Competition. Our team from New Vision Health won 1st place in the Health Knowledge Bowl Contest. The team members are April White (SW), Josue Ramos (TVCS), Robert Johaneman (LMCS) and Carly Klemen (MCS). They will be attending the Skills USA National competition June 24 – 28 in Kansas City, MO.

Page 3: Career & Technical Educationschoolboard.scboces.org/attachments/3c672111-1416...Career & Technical Education Skills, Knowledge and Work Ethic for the 21st Century Denise A. Sullivan,

Career & Technical Education Skills, Knowledge and Work Ethic for the 21st Century

Denise A. Sullivan, Director May 2012

Page 3 of 8

Courtney Banks (RCS) won 2nd place in the Health Occupations Professional Portfolio competition.

Josh DeCarlo (LCS) won 3rd place in the Residential Systems Installation and Maintenance competition.

Honorable mention goes to Michele Edwards (TVCS), who came in 4th place in the Cosmetology Senior competition. Michelle scored a 92 out of 100 on the written exam, and had perfect scores in the both the updo and Haircut 1 practical demonstrations. Congratulations to all 22 of our students who attended the competition. They were exemplary in their effort and behavior on the trip. Special thanks go to lead advisor Aaron Ward, and teachers Lori Scardino, Robert Culver, Gloria Cahalan and Peggy Schleiermacher who acted as advisors and chaperones to the students.

Alt. Ed. Senior Symposium The Senior Class continues to work on completing requirements for graduation which has included; attending town and board meetings, course work, regents preparation, community service hours and credit recovery completion via the E20/20 computer program. The Senior Class recently "cooked a breakfast" and enjoyed some "down time" together. Currently seniors are being encouraged to consider completion of applications for scholarships and choose a class speaker for graduation.
